The audience's primary emotional response to 'What to Do in Case of Fire' is driven by its strong comedic elements, featuring significant Humor, Joy, and Happiness as the former anarchists reunite. This is balanced by a deep dramatic core, evoking Empathy, Sadness, Melancholy, and Nostalgia as the characters confront their past and the reasons for their separation. The 'action' aspect contributes to Anticipation and Excitement, leading to a sense of Satisfaction and Relief as they come to grips with their history and ideals.
